Husky Mentors is a registered student organization (RSO) at the University of Washington that connects incoming freshmen and transfer students with upperclassmen mentors Mentors and mentees are paired according to academic and extracurricular interests, and mentors will act as a resource and a friendly face for their peer mentees through the summer and fall.
As a Husky Mentor you will volunteer during the upcoming schools year to help freshmen and transfer students make the transition into college life.
